Transaction 644d5255c7ab2adaafda03900f2c2bbeeb70abc146b61106938b533f9959dd06

2 Input
2 Outputs
  • 644d5255c7ab2adaafda03900f2c2bbeeb70abc146b61106938b533f9959dd06:0
  • value  3083829
    address  17J2JYutey1HFKiUNn5BEA62xwSWHPKRJV
  • 644d5255c7ab2adaafda03900f2c2bbeeb70abc146b61106938b533f9959dd06:1
  • value  2207192
    address  1L7bYPuS2xrWkb2EkxRZpfzrgy6bicfJ8B